Description
Multi-layered scalable bit-stream distribution requires protection for the rendering and transmission of its individual layers. This paper presents a sufficient encryption (SE) scheme for SVC layers which maintains the compression efficiency and the format compliancy of scalable bit-streams, without compromising the security. The purpose of SE is achieved by applying the partial encryption on carefully selected codewords and bin-strings of the CAVLC and CABAC of H.264/SVC respectively. The performance of the scheme is tested on various resolution sequences, which demonstrate the advantages of the scheme when compared to alternative techniques. These advantages include: minimal computational delay by encrypting partial data; no bit-rate escalation by keeping the compression ratio unchanged; and, format compliancy of the bit-stream at the decoder.
